The El Paso Carnival 2026, celebrated throughout February and early March, fills the town with colour, music and shared joy.
It is a close, creative and family friendly carnival.
The programme combines children’s activities, street parades, contests, themed parties and events for young people and seniors.
Among the highlights are the Fiesta de la Peluca, Carnival in the Street, school parades, the symbolic Burial of the Rabbit and the popular Senior Carnival.
El Paso Carnival Programme 2026
Friday, 6 February
Children’s costume party
- From 5.00 pm, a large children’s carnival party will take place.
There will be creative workshops, inflatable attractions, music, children’s characters and games.
A safe and fun event for the whole family. El Paso Municipal Market.
Saturday, 7 February
Carnival in the Street
- At 2.00 pm the activities begin with the workshop Decorate Your Wig, inflatable games, a mechanical bull, the fantasy workshop Glitter Yara and music by DJ Xavi. Plaza Francisca de Gazmira.
- At 3.00 pm, Margullando in pairs will take place. A carnival style version of the Fiesta de la Peluca, including a gastronomic contest. Previous registration is required from 26 to 30 January. Calle Manuel Taño.
- At 5.30 pm, the Carnival Parranda will start, with a train ride from Barranco de Las Canales to Avenida Islas Canarias. The parade will be accompanied by A.F. Volcán de San Juan and masked participants.
- At 6.30 pm, a large street parade will take place, featuring Batucada Badakatun, La Charanga, Carolina Ramírez’s Kids Zumba Group, Comparsa Río de Fuego, Comparsa Samba do Corazao, Comparsa Samba do Corazao Junior, carnival characters and children’s characters. The route runs from José María Brito Pérez Street to Manuel Taño Street.
- At 7.00 pm, the El Espejo Mágico photo booth will be available. Visitors can take home a printed souvenir from the Fiesta de la Peluca. Manuel Taño Street, corner of Avenida Islas Canarias.
- Also at 7.00 pm, the El Paso Crece photocall will take place. A contest for the most original and fun wig, organised by the El Paso Crece Business Association. Participants can win shopping vouchers for local businesses. Town Hall Atrium.
- At 7.30 pm, the main event begins. Fiesta de la Peluca, with performances by Salvapantallas, Nueva Línea, Tropicana’s, Yet Garbey, DJ Visac and DJ Wes. Fermín Sosa Street.
Friday, 20 February
Carnival Parade “El Mar”
- At 10.30 am, the themed carnival parade El Mar will take place.
Participants include CEIP Adamancasis, CEIP La Rosa Camino Viejo, CEIP Arco Iris, CEIP Jedey, EIM Doña Carmela, El Árbol Children’s Leisure Centre, IES El Paso and the senior citizens’ group. The parade will follow the main streets of the town and finish at Plaza Francisca de Gazmira. A truly intergenerational carnival event.
Saturday, 7 March
Burial of the Rabbit and Senior Carnival
- At 3.00 pm, the traditional Burial of the Rabbit will be celebrated.
The event will feature Parranda La Laja, Parranda Por Montera, Batucada Badakatun, the murgas Los Canchanchanes and Ni Sí Ni No, the show Yo Marc, a tribute to Marc Anthony, and music by DJ Padilla and DJ Renzo. Avenida Islas Canarias. - At 5.30 pm, the Senior Carnival will take place. An Indian themed party with live music by Los Chicos del Son. There will be a contest for the most original outfit. Categories include individual and couple. Senior Citizens’ Centre.
